Qureshi, Uzbekistan – The Emirates Girls Club team began its campaign in the preliminary round of the 2026 – 2027 AFC Women’s Champions League with a 1-1 draw with the Bhutanese Royal Thimbo College team. In the match that brought them together yesterday at the Central Stadium in the Uzbek city of Qarshi, as part of the third group competitions.
The Bhutanese team took the lead in the first half, before the Emirates Girls team succeeded in equalizing during the last minutes through Salha Rashid Al Zaabi. To score his first point at the beginning of his journey in the tournament.
The UAE girls’ team will meet in the second round on Thursday with the Master team from Laos. Meanwhile, Royal Thimbo College faces the Uzbek team Nasaf.
